The All High (Al-A'alaa)
In the Name of Allah, the Beneficent, the Merciful
۞ Glorify the Name of your Lord, the Most High, 1 The One Who created, and then made proper. 2 decreed their destinies, and provided them with guidance. 3 Who bringeth forth the pasturage, 4 then made it dry dark, flaky stubble, 5 By degrees shall We teach thee to declare (the Message), so thou shalt not forget, 6 unless God wills it to be otherwise. He knows all that is made public and all that remains hidden. 7 And We shall ease thy way unto the state of ease. 8 So render good counsel if good counsel will avail. 9 and he who fears shall remember, 10 And the most unfortunate one will avoid it, 11 [He] who will [enter and] burn in the greatest Fire, 12 wherein he will neither die nor remain alive. 13 Prosperous is he who has cleansed himself, 14 And recites the name of his Lord and serves with devotion. 15 Nay (behold), ye prefer the life of this world; 16 but the Everlasting Life is better, and more enduring. 17 Surely this is in the ancient scrolls, 18 the Scriptures of Abraham and Moses. 19
